crispinb/dash-clojuredocs

Exception (Selmer validation error) thrown during crawl

Closed this issue · 0 comments

20-08-24 03:47:35 bamboo INFO [pegasus.queue:59] - :obtained http://clojuredocs.org/clojure.test.junit/suite-attrs
20-08-24 03:47:35 bamboo INFO [pegasus.defaults:253] - :num-visited 1395
20-08-24 03:47:35 bamboo INFO [pegasus.defaults:262] - :stopping-crawl!
20-08-24 03:47:35 bamboo INFO [pegasus.defaults:267] - :stop-items 2
Exception in thread "main" clojure.lang.ExceptionInfo: resource-path for template.html returned nil, typically means the file doesn't exist in your classpath. {:type :selmer-validation-error, :error "resource-path for template.html returned nil, typically means the file doesn't exist in your classpath.", :error-template "<html>\n<head>\n    <font face='arial'>\n        <style type='text/css'>\n            body {\n                margin: 0px;\n                background: #ececec;\n            }\n            #header {\n                padding-top:  5px;\n                padding-left: 25px;\n                color: white;\n                background: #a32306;\n                text-shadow: 1px 1px #33333;\n                border-bottom: 1px solid #710000;\n            }\n            #error-wrap {\n                border-top: 5px solid #d46e6b;\n            }\n            #error-message {\n                color: #800000;\n                background: #f5a29f;\n                padding: 10px;\n                text-shadow: 1px 1px #FFBBBB;\n                border-top: 1px solid #f4b1ae;\n            }\n            #file-wrap {\n                border-top: 5px solid #2a2a2a;\n            }\n            #file {\n                color: white;\n                background: #333333;\n                padding: 10px;\n                padding-left: 20px;\n                text-shadow: 1px 1px #55              background: #d6d6d6;\n                float: left;\n                padding: 5px;\n                text-shadow: 1px 1px #EEEEEE;\n                border-right: 1px solid #b6b6b6;\n            }\n            #line-content {\n                float: left;\n                padding: 5px;\n            }\n            #error-content {\n                float: left;\n                width: 100%;\n                border-top: 5px solid #cdcdcd;\n                  }\n        </style>\n</head>\n<body>\n<div id='header'>\n    <h1>Template Compilation Error</h1>\n</div>\n<div id='error-wrap'>\n    <div id='error-message'>{{error}}.</div>\n</div>\n{% if template %}\n<div id='file-wrap'>\n    <div id='file'>In {{template}}{% if line %} on line {{line}}{% endif %}.</div>\n</div>\n{% for error in validation-errors %}\n<div id='error-content'>\n    <div id='line-number'>{{error.line}}</div>\n    <div id='line-content'>{{error.tag}}</div>\n</div>\n{% endfor %}\n{% endif %}\n</body>\n</html>", :line nil, :template nil, :validation-errors ({:tag "   ", :line nil})}
        at clojure.core$ex_info.invokeStatic(core.clj:4617)
        at clojure.core$ex_info.invoke(core.clj:4617)
        at selmer.validator$validation_error.invokeStatic(validator.clj:33)
        at selmer.validator$validation_error.invoke(validator.clj:23)
        at selmer.validator$validation_error.invokeStatic(validator.clj:25)
        at selmer.validator$validation_error.invoke(validator.clj:23)
        at selmer.parser$render_file.invokeStatic(parser.clj:135)
        at selmer.parser$render_file.doInvoke(parser.clj:114)
        at clojure.lang.RestFn.invoke(RestFn.java:425)
        at dash_clojuredocs.core$example_template.invokeStatic(core.clj:53)
        at dash_clojuredocs.core$example_template.invoke(core.clj:52)
        at dash_clojuredocs.core$handle_content.invokeStatic(core.clj:78)
        at dash_clojuredocs.core$handle_content.invoke(core.clj:77)
        at dash_clojuredocs.core$map_source.invokeStatic(core.clj:110)
        at dash_clojuredocs.core$map_source.invoke(core.clj:100)
        at dash_clojuredocs.core$handle_source.invokeStatic(core.clj:139)
        at dash_clojuredocs.core$handle_source.invoke(core.clj:128)
        at dash_clojuredocs.core$crawl_clojuredocs.invokeStatic(core.clj:210)
        at dash_clojuredocs.core$crawl_clojuredocs.invoke(core.clj:195)
        at dash_clojuredocs.core$_main.invokeStatic(core.clj:214)
        at dash_clojuredocs.core$_main.invoke(core.clj:212)
        at clojure.lang.Var.invoke(Var.java:375)
        at clojure.lang.AFn.applyToHelper(AFn.java:152)
        at clojure.lang.Var.applyTo(Var.java:700)
        at clojure.core$apply.invokeStatic(core.clj:646)
        at clojure.main$main_opt.invokeStatic(main.clj:314)
        at clojure.main$main_opt.invoke(main.clj:310)
        at clojure.main$main.invokeStatic(main.clj:421)
        at clojure.main$main.doInvoke(main.clj:384)
        at clojure.lang.RestFn.invoke(RestFn.java:421)
        at clojure.lang.Var.invoke(Var.java:383)
        at clojure.lang.AFn.applyToHelper(AFn.java:156)
        at clojure.lang.Var.applyTo(Var.java:700)
        at clojure.main.main(main.java:37)